116510 2003-01-25 22:54:00 Just for you Billy T, NIS is Norton Internet Security.

The flashing is just indicating that NIS has intercepted a possible attack but you'll not need to worry about it since Nortons has stopped it. You'll just have to put up with the flashing until the Admin returns. Since it'll give the Admin a message on what the attack was.
